Output d63fb76515e25a84197127476ba8b650700b9414bba33d7da0e4de91f3f51e7d:12

value
36086
script pubkey
OP_0 OP_PUSHBYTES_20 687535eb5e46034daa9dba341d66d40f42397c09
address
bc1qdp6nt667gcp5m25ahg6p6ek5paprjlqfhzkm0j
transaction
d63fb76515e25a84197127476ba8b650700b9414bba33d7da0e4de91f3f51e7d